gpg-interface.c: use flags to determine key/signer info presence

Replace the logic used to determine whether key and signer information
is present to use explicit flags in sigcheck_gpg_status[] array.  This
is more future-proof, since it makes it possible to add additional
statuses without having to explicitly update the conditions.
